Default 4.6 stroker kit?

im looking into getting something big for my 97 gt (auto), ive looked into turbo's, superchargers, and nitrous, but havent found out much about strokers for 4.6 2v. How much of a power gain would you get off a stroker kit for a 4.6 2valve, and how much of a stroke could you get for it?

Default RE: 4.6 stroker kit?

Stroker kits dont give you much gain unless you're blown. The best kit is the 5.1 stroker kit and YOU NEED to get the stroker block. Trying to bore a 4.6 alluminum block causes it to becuase too weak. for 2500 they have the block, forged pistons and rods, forged crank.
